SELF-ADHESIVE WATERPROOFING MEMBRANES

Self-adhesive waterproofing membranes are thin layers allocated over a surface to prevent water from contacting other materials. Self-adhesive waterproofing membranes are mostly adhesive or laid on top of the material or structure they are supposed to protect.

SUNPRUFE: Self-adhesive HDPE waterproofing membrane
  • Basement waterproofing
  • Waterproofing of cut and covered tunnels, subways, metros, and caves.
  • Other underground public constructions
  • For waterproofing and protection of slabs and confined walls below ground
  • Prevent coal gas, marsh gas, and methane leakage in the underground layer
  • Resistant to seawater, chlorides, and alkali
  • Chemical stability against common organic and inorganic acids, alkalis, salts, and organic solvents
  • Saving cost and time
  • No protection layer required
  • Fast installation
  • Excellent waste management
  • Anti-sedimentation and anti-cracking
  • It provides a complete barrier to water, moisture, and gas
  • Cold applied, easy to install, does not require primer or fillet
  • Solar reflection, being white in colour, thereby reduces temperature gain
  • Smooth surface membrane
  • Seals adhesively to concrete
  • Highly chemical resistant, effective in all types of soils and waters
  • Protect structures from chlorides, sulphates, and aggressive ground condition
  • Excellent bonding with concrete applied on the membrane
  • Low flatness requirement to a substrate; reliable overlapping; mechanical fixing, easy application
  • Sound anti-puncture performance and adaptability to settlement and distortion
  • SUNPRUFE membranes are supplied in rolls 1.2 m wide
  • The membranes incorporate dual adhesive layers with coloured zip strips
  • The strips are at the top and bottom of the seam area on the edge of the roll
  • This enables even stronger bonded laps between adjacent rolls
  • Both zip strips cover an aggressive adhesive
  • Remove the zip strip on the top and the bottom of the membrane
  • Once the strips are removed, a strong adhesive bond is achieved in the overlap area

SUNPRUFE SBS: Self-adhesive SBS-modified waterproofing membrane
  • Industrial and civil buildings, basements, and tunnels
  • Underground pipe gallery, water conservation
  • Deck waterproofing
  • Excellent low-temperature performance, especially suitable for cold area applications
  • Good weather resistance, tensile property, high elongation, wear resistance, and excellent workability
  • Excellent adhesion to any vertical or horizontal surface
  • Polymer-rich compound, an easy and strong seal on overlaps
  • High mechanical strength and fatigue resistance properties
  • No curing time instantly waterproofs the substrate
  • Uniform thickness-eliminating likelihood of uneven application possible with a liquid-applied membrane
  • The surface should be cleaned thoroughly of all contaminants
  • Contaminants could be dust, traces of curing compound, oil, and grease
  • Remove and repair all surface imperfections, protrusions, and structurally unsound and friable concrete
  • The substrate must be moist but without stagnant water
  • Sprinkle water over the substrate if too dry
  • The application temperature should be between 5oC to 55o C
  • Apply a primer coat of SUNBITUPRIME at the rate of 10 sq m per kg and allow it to cure for 6-8 hours
  • On the primed surface, begin laying the membrane at the lowest point of the roof
  • Gradually move towards the higher areas
  • Unroll the membrane halfway, align the side laps
  • Fix SUNPRUFE SBS membranes by applying uniform pressure with a roller/wet cloth
  • The above application ensures the removal of entrapped air if any
  • An overlapping joint shall be provided of 80-150 mm in the longitudinal direction
  • Overlap joint shall be provided of 80-150 mm in the transverse direction
  • For a trafficable roof, the SUNPRUFE SBS waterproofing system shall be protected
  • Dose PCC with SUNPLEX of 50 mm thick tiles
  • The tiles are loosely laid or fixed over a separation layer of spot bonded geotextile of 120/150 GSM

SUNPRUFE PVC: PVC waterproofing membrane
  • Basement waterproofing
  • Tunnel waterproofing
  • Podiums and covered roof waterproofing
  • Reservoirs, lakes, and canal lining
  • The Signal layer indicates damages due to handling and installation
  • Superior mechanical characteristics
  • Excellent tensile and elongation properties
  • Superior dimensional stability after heat treatment
  • Good flexibility at low temperatures
  • Excellent puncture resistance
  • Fast application, loosely laid on horizontal surfaces
  • Resistant to root penetration
  • Easy to handle, install and repair
  • Excellent impermeability to water ingress
  • Efficient hot air welded seam
  • Very high level of water tightness
  • Long life expectancy
  • Double weld of joints allows for a pressure test of joints
  • Resistant to bursting at a high water pressure
  • Lay geotextile/protective felt loosely as a base layer
  • For the horizontal surface, use suitable fixings given by the manufacturer over vertical or shotcrete surface
  • With an overlap of 50-100 mm joined by point welding or a similar suitable method
  • Lay SUNPRUFE PVC loosely laid on the horizontal surface over geotextile/protective felt
  • Lay SUNPRUFE PVC with roundels on the geotextiles/protective felt over vertical or tunnel surfaces
  • No perforation of the membrane shall be allowed
  • Ensure that the membrane is laid with a signal layer toward the inside
  • And with adequate slack to prevent over-stressing during concreting
  • Provide overlap joints of 75 mm in both longitudinal and transverse directions of the SUNPRUFE PVC
  • Make sure that joints are sealed properly with hot air welding only by a double weld
  • Terminate SUNPRUFE PVC at the top of the parapet wall with a termination strip
  • Fix it by screwing at 300 mm c/c
  • All termination strips shall be sealed with a water lock sealant and topped up by a suitable sealant
  • All seams should be tested using a suitable method of seam testing
  • Every care should be taken to protect the membrane during and after installation
  • Any damages may be repaired and tested before casting the final concrete lining
